    Understanding the Narcissist Silent Treatment

    Silent treatment from a narcissist can be emotionally draining and bewildering. Understanding the reasons behind this behavior can help you navigate through these challenging situations with more clarity and confidence.

    Unveiling Their Motives

    Narcissists often use silent treatment as a manipulation tactic to exert control and power over others. By withholding communication, they aim to provoke a reaction, instill fear, or punish you for not meeting their expectations. Recognizing this underlying motive can empower you to respond effectively.

    Deciphering the Silence

    The silence from a narcissist can stem from their deep-seated insecurities and need for validation. In the absence of admiration or compliance with their demands, they resort to silence as a way to maintain superiority and fuel their ego. Understanding that the silent treatment is more about them than you can help you detach emotionally.

    Responding Strategically

    When faced with the narcissist’s silent treatment, it’s crucial to set boundaries and prioritize your emotional well-being. Avoid escalating the situation by engaging in a power struggle or seeking validation from the narcissist. Instead, focus on self-care, maintaining your composure, and seeking support from trusted individuals.

    Communicating Effectively

    While it may be tempting to break the silence or confront the narcissist, practicing assertive communication can yield better outcomes. Use “I” statements to express your feelings and boundaries calmly. Avoid blaming or accusing language, as this can fuel further conflict. By asserting yourself respectfully, you assert your worth and reinforce boundaries.

    Nurturing Healthy Relationships

    Dealing with the silent treatment from a narcissist can illuminate the importance of fostering healthy relationships built on mutual respect and communication. Surround yourself with individuals who value open dialogue, empathy, and understanding. Cultivating these connections can help you reclaim your power and establish fulfilling relationships based on transparency and respect.

    Strategies for Responding to the Narcissist Silent Treatment

    When faced with the challenging situation of receiving the silent treatment from a narcissist, it’s essential to equip yourself with strategies that can help you navigate this emotionally taxing experience effectively. Here are actionable steps you can take to respond to the narcissist silent treatment:

    Setting Clear Boundaries

    Establishing firm boundaries is crucial when dealing with a narcissist who resorts to silence as a means of control. Communicate your boundaries clearly and assertively, letting the narcissist know what behaviors are unacceptable. By setting boundaries, you assert your autonomy and protect your emotional well-being.

    Prioritizing Your Emotional Well-Being

    Focus on self-care and prioritize your emotional health during periods of silent treatment. Engage in activities that bring you joy and peace, such as exercise, meditation, or spending time with supportive friends and family. Remember that self-care is not selfish but essential for maintaining your mental and emotional resilience.

    Practicing Assertive Communication

    When engaging with the narcissist, choose your words thoughtfully and maintain a calm demeanor. Practice assertive communication by expressing your thoughts and feelings directly, without aggression or hostility. Be confident in asserting your needs and refuse to accept disrespectful behavior.

    Seeking Support from Trusted Individuals

    Reach out to trustworthy friends, a therapist, or a support group to share your experiences and seek guidance. Talking to others can provide valuable perspective and emotional support during challenging times. Surround yourself with people who uplift and validate your feelings.

    Refraining from Reacting Emotionally

    Resist the urge to react impulsively or emotionally to the silent treatment. Stay composed and avoid being drawn into unnecessary conflict. Remember that your reactions can fuel the narcissist’s manipulative tactics. By remaining calm and composed, you maintain your inner strength.

    Setting Realistic Expectations

    Manage your expectations when dealing with a narcissist prone to using the silent treatment. Understand that you cannot change the narcissist’s behavior, but you can control how you respond to it. Focus on protecting your well-being rather than seeking validation or approval from the narcissist.

    Establishing Healthy Relationships

    Invest in nurturing relationships built on mutual respect, empathy, and open communication. Surround yourself with individuals who value your feelings and treat you with kindness. Cultivating healthy connections can empower you to break free from toxic dynamics and foster positive interactions.
